14 + 2y - 3+ 7x - 12y +3x - 20=

Answer:

The answer is 10x - 10y - 9

Step-by-step explanation:

14 - 3 - 20 = -9

2y - 12y = -10y

7x + 3x = 10x

14 + 2y - 3 + 7x - 12y + 3x - 20 = 10x - 10y - 9

The vertices of a triangle are located at X(-2,-1), Y(2,5) and Z(4,3). What is the perimeter of this triangle?
Lana71 [14]
If you plot the points you will find you have to use the distance formula. Pick out 2 pairs label them (x1,y1) (x2,y2) then plug it into the distance formula. The repeat for the other sides. So you should get (2,5) (4,3) plug into distance formula what is get it distance between those two points, then (4,3) (-2,-1) plug into distance formula to get an answer, lastly (-2,-1) (2,5) plug in. Now you have three answers add all together and here is your perimeter of a triangle.
